    I've mentioned before having been raised, an lived in or around Washington, DC in my younger years. DC had a very strict rule on handguns. It was illegal to own one. Let alone carry. Guess what it did for our crime rates? Nothing. All through the 80s, DC was either number 1 for murder/violent crimes, or in the top 3. Anyone from Chicago can say the same. Very Strict. Yet..tons of gun and gang violence. Just two examples of why banning guns won't work, an just proves the statments by Oldude an many many others "If you ban guns only the criminals will have them". That was proven in two cities. High Murder Rates, High Police brutality claims, etc. Not sure if the Brutality really changes much but the rates are high for both cities, or were.
